1. Understanding Osteoporosis - A Silent Thief

Osteoporosis. Photo Credit: Envato @ABBPhoto

Osteoporosis often goes unnoticed until a fracture occurs, earning it the moniker "the silent thief." This condition gradually erodes bone density, making bones porous and fragile. Understanding the mechanisms behind osteoporosis is crucial for prevention. Bone is a living tissue, constantly being broken down and rebuilt. Osteoporosis occurs when the creation of new bone doesn't keep up with the removal of old bone. Factors such as age, gender, genetics, and lifestyle choices play significant roles in bone density. Women, particularly post-menopausal women, are at higher risk due to hormonal changes that affect bone resorption. Men, too, are susceptible, though typically at a later age. Awareness of these factors is the first step in combating osteoporosis.
